HookTracer: A System for Automated and Accessible API Hooks Analysis. (July 2019)
- Record Type:
- Journal Article
- Title:
- HookTracer: A System for Automated and Accessible API Hooks Analysis. (July 2019)
- Main Title:
- HookTracer: A System for Automated and Accessible API Hooks Analysis
- Authors:
- Case, Andrew
Jalalzai, Mohammad M.
Firoz-Ul-Amin, Md
Maggio, Ryan D.
Ali-Gombe, Aisha
Sun, Mingxuan
Richard, Golden G. - Abstract:
- Abstract: The use of memory forensics is becoming commonplace in digital investigation and incident response, as it provides critically important capabilities for detecting sophisticated malware attacks, including memory-only malware components. In this paper, we concentrate on improving analysis of API hooks, a technique commonly employed by malware to hijack the execution flow of legitimate functions. These hooks allow the malware to gain control at critical times and to exercise complete control over function arguments and return values. Existing techniques for detecting hooks, such the Volatility plugin apihooks, do a credible job, but generate numerous false positives related to non-malicious use of API hooking. Furthermore, deeper analysis to determine the nature of hooks detected by apihooks typically requires substantial skill in reverse engineering and an extensive knowledge of operating systems internals. In this paper, we present a new, highly configurable tool called hooktracer, which eliminates false positives, provides valuable insight into the operation of detected hooks, and generates portable signatures called hook traces, which can be used to rapidly investigate large numbers of machines for signs of malware infection.
- Is Part Of:
- Digital investigation. Volume 29(2019)Supplement
- Journal:
- Digital investigation
- Issue:
- Volume 29(2019)Supplement
- Issue Display:
- Volume 29, Issue 2019 (2019)
- Year:
- 2019
- Volume:
- 29
- Issue:
- 2019
- Issue Sort Value:
- 2019-0029-2019-0000
- Page Start:
- S104
- Page End:
- S112
- Publication Date:
- 2019-07
- Subjects:
- Memory forensics -- Malware -- Memory analysis -- API hooks -- Unicorn -- Emulation
Forensic sciences -- Data processing -- Periodicals
Criminal investigation -- Data processing -- Periodicals
363.250285 - Journal URLs:
- http://www.sciencedirect.com/science/journal/17422876 ↗
http://www.elsevier.com/journals ↗ - DOI:
- 10.1016/j.diin.2019.04.011 ↗
- Languages:
- English
- ISSNs:
- 1742-2876
- Deposit Type:
- Legaldeposit
- View Content:
- Available online (eLD content is only available in our Reading Rooms) ↗
- Physical Locations:
- British Library DSC - 3588.396620
British Library DSC - BLDSS-3PM
British Library STI - ELD Digital store - Ingest File:
- 11048.xml